Eonon Nav/DVD/CD unit
 
I have a 2005 X5 and I'm trying to install this POS head unit. I followed the other DSP work around I found on here and it doesn't work. I have the extension cable I bought from Eonon and routed it from the Head unit back to the rear near the AMP. My problem is no sound at all. I'm guessing the head unit is not turning on the AMP

ScottJ 05-19-2015 03:16 PM

You may be encountering issues related to your X5 having DSP. To confirm that, I would temporarily hook up loose speakers to the Eonon's speaker level outputs, and listen for audio.
